Updated: 7:55 a.m. July 18

First discovered: 3 days ago, 7:05 p.m. July 15

Initial location: Little Valley Road and Spring Gulch Road, 12 miles southeast of Bieber, Lassen County, Calif.

Fire unit: Cal Fire Lassen-Modoc Unit

Fire type: Wildfire

Fire name: 3-6 Fire

3-6 Fire initially started 7:05 p.m. July 15 at Little Valley Road and Spring Gulch Road, 12 miles southeast of Bieber in Lassen County, California.

As of Saturday morning, 205.2 acres of land had been consumed by it. By Saturday morning, the fire crew effectively contained 12% of this wildfire. At present, there are no details on the cause of the fire.

Fire containment

What does it mean for a fire to be 12% contained?

The percentage indicates how much of the fire perimeter has been surrounded by a control line. In this case, it means that 12% of the wildfire is halted from spreading, while 88% is still uncontrolled.

Containment is part of a larger plan for managing a wildfire. It is normally expressed as a percentage and it refers to how much of the fire perimeter has been surrounded/enclosed by a control line that firefighters create. The containment percentage indicates a certain level of control, but it doesn't always correlate to safety level. Also, it's important to note that containment doesn't mean a fire is out.

How is containment measured?

The incident's central command constantly receives progress reports from firefighters on the ground. As the fireline is constructed, inspected or reinforced, mappers record those details to adjust the containment percentage. The percentage tells the public how much of the fire perimeter is believed to not go beyond the control lines.
